What does this involve?
Dedicated, one-to-one support is available for businesses, social enterprises and individuals in the Highlands and Islands that work in or engage with the creative sector.
This support is free to access and will be tailored around the specific requirements of your business or social enterprise. The programmes will be delivered by a range of passionate sector specialists with extensive experience producing support programmes for creative businesses across the Highlands and Islands.
Support is available in the following areas and is in the form of one-to-one seminars which will vary in length dependent on need:
- screen and broadcast
- craft, fashion and textiles
- writing and publishing
- digital & technology
- heritage
- music

What does this cost?
The support is free, but it is subject to state subsidy assessment and if appropriate, your available de minimis allowance.
Who is this for?
For businesses, social enterprises and individuals in the Highlands and Islands that work in or with the creative industries.
How long does this take?
The timescale for support will vary, based on your individual needs. Once you submit an enquiry, you'll receive an acknowledgement receipt of your mail and the team will get back to you fully as soon as possible.
